Putto candelabrum   Filippo della Valle (1697–1768)

Putto candelabrum

Filippo della Valle (1697–1768)

this site may contain automatically translated text
Putto als Leuchterträger
Material/technique
bronze
Measurements
78 × 40 × 34 cm, c.
Acquisition
old family property
Artists/makers/authors
Filippo della Valle
Detailed information
Inventory number
SK 362
Provenance
old family property
Iconography
putti, amoretti
Literature
K. Lankheit, Die Modellsammlung der Porzellanmanufaktur Doccia. Ein Dokument italienischer Barockplastik, München 1982, S. 114, Abb. 83 (als Soldani)

J. Montagu, Rezension von Lankheit, in: The Burlington Magazine 125 1983, S. 759 (als della Valle)

V.H. Minor, Filippo della Valle as Metalworker, in: The Art Bulletin 66 1984, S. 511-514, Abb. 7
